Texas optimistic about Scott
Most recruiting analysts rank Texas as a slight favorite over Colorado in the race to sign Darrell Scott, the nation's top-ranked HS running back, today. Scott will make his announcement live at 11:50 a.m. on ESPNU.
Scott has an uncle who plays for Colorado -- they're only one year apart in age and played together in HS -- so the Buffs have a strong emotional pull working for them. Texas, however, has an immediate vacancy at TB, now that leading rusher Jamaal Charles is headed to the NFL.
Scott's decision is the lone hanging chad in determining whether Texas' class cracks the Top 10 nationally. It's a borderline group without him, a Top 10 class with him. Already, nine incoming freshmen are enrolled for the spring semester and will take part in spring drills: OL Mark Buchanan, WR Dan Buckner, RB Brock Fitzhenry, DB Blake Gideon, RB Jeremy Hills, LB Dravannti Johnson, RB Tre Newton, OL David Snow and K Justin Tucker.
Texas is expected to sign 20 or 21 players, depending on Scott's decision.
